Charming Front Door Covers & Ideas
Just as the garage door sets the mood for your home exterior, your front door offers a chance to greet visitors with warmth and personality. There are countless Valentine’s Day decoration ideas for the front door that complement your garage styling.
1. Heart Wreaths and Garland Frames
A heart-shaped wreath made of faux roses, felt hearts, ribbon, or even seasonal greenery instantly creates a festive greeting. Ranging from elegant to whimsical, wreaths are one of the most versatile Valentine’s Day decoration ideas you can use year after year.
Garlands — especially those with felt or paper hearts — add movement and charm. Drape them around or above your front door, letting them sway gently in the breeze for a cozy yet whimsical effect.
2. Love-Themed Welcome Signs
A welcome sign that pledges love or seasonal greetings instantly elevates your entryway. These can be crafted from wood, chalkboard, or printed materials that use romantic scripts and pastel hues. This personalized touch brings a heartfelt message to every arrival.
3. Lanterns & Fairy Lights
Soft lighting creates warmth associated with Valentine’s Day evenings. Lanterns with LED candles — either traditional or shaped like hearts — frame the front door beautifully. Pair them with fairy lights to highlight architectural features of your doorway.
4. Seasonal Doormats & Potted Accents
Never underestimate the impact of a themed doormat. A heart-shaped or Valentine’s Day message mat extends hospitality to all who visit. Placing potted plants with blossoms in Valentine colors like red and white can add natural beauty to your entry.

Tips for Installing & Styling Covers
Decorating large outdoor surfaces doesn’t have to be difficult. Here are a few practical tips to make the most of your Valentine’s Day decor:
Use Adhesive Velcro Strips for Easy Setup
For garage door covers and many decorative elements, adhesive Velcro strips are an efficient way to hang without tools or damage. These strips make installation quick and removal easy — perfect for seasonal decorating.
Before applying Velcro, clean the surface well to ensure it sticks securely. Once attached, these strips support the weight of lightweight banners and door covers throughout the holiday.
Balance Scale & Proportion
Larger covers — such as heart-scenic garage door wraps — make a bold statement. To keep visual balance, use complementary accents at a smaller scale on your front door or porch. This could be a wreath or small signage that echoes the main motif.
Light Up the Night
Add soft lighting to draw attention to your decorations after sunset. Fairy lights, lanterns, and LED accents can highlight texture and create a cozy mood that’s perfect for Valentine’s evenings.
